    Description

    Redwood Run Disc Golf Course is a 27 hole course at the Boulder Creek Golf Course, where disc golfers tee off along side traditional golfers. The course is open Mondays, Thursdays, and Saturdays from 11:30AM to 5:30PM.  Per player fees are $12.00 for 27 holes, $9 for 18 holes & $5 for 9 holes. Electric carts are available (fee) when weather and course conditions permit.
